Theophan the Recluse, also known as Theophanes the Recluse or the Enlightener Theophan the Recluse of Vysha was a bishop of the Russian Orthodox Church and theologian, recognized as a saint in 1988. He is best known today through the books and letters he wrote concerning spiritual life, especially on the subjects of the Christian life and the training of youth in the faith.
